There's much more to marketing or
consumer research than conducting a "project", which connotes
a single methodology such as a phone survey or set of focus
groups. Research Strategy should not be a "one off" exercise but
a carefully thought-out, flexible process that considers—
- Input from all or most functional areas of an
organization
- The need to standardize metrics so that no matter where
in the organization a research effort originates, there is
consistency and trackability—Enterprise Feedback
Management.
- The importance of identifying all stakeholders before
launching a research initiative.
This perspective is especially important when considering
specialized methodologies that are often executed by just that,
specialists who often do not have the bigger picture or who only
participate in a specific part of the process. For example, in
the case of focus groups, where there are so many different
players involved, a strategic perspective assures that the
exercise is
a rich source of actionable data and not a meaningless meeting of
minds.
A Qualitative Research Consultant (QRC)
Dave Roberts is not only a skilled focus group Moderator (over 4,000
since 1979), he is a
true Qualitative Research Consultant (QRC), attending to all of
the details that determine a successful set of focus groups—
- Assist the client in defining the research goals and determining the
target audience.
- Design a Screener questionnaire that assures the recruiting of
qualified respondents.
- Select a quality focus group facility/recruiting firm in each market. Dave
has worked with hundreds of facilities nationwide.
- Closely audit the recruiting process on a daily basis and keep the client
informed. No surprises!
- Design a comprehensive Moderator Outline to assure all topics of
interest are explored.
- Design an In-Session Questionnaire to quantify certain
responses such as ratings scales and open-ended lists.
- Moderate the Groups
- Prepare a detailed and actionable Executive Summary supported by Verbatim
Responses, In-Session Questionnaire Data, Graphs, Tables, & Recommendations.
